| # Overview of PyTorch STM32 Model Zoo for Object Detection |
|
|
| The STM32 model zoo includes several PyTorch-based models for object detection use cases, converted to ONNX format and optimized for STM32N6 NPU deployment. All models are pre-trained on ImageNet and quantized using QDQ INT8 quantization. |
|
|
| ## Model Categories |
|
|
| - `ST_pretrainedmodel_public_dataset` contains PyTorch object detection models pretrained by ST on open source datasets such as MS COCO, Pascal VOC, COCO person and converted to ONNX format with QDQ quantization. |

| ### Single Shot Detector (SSD) Models |
| Variation of SSD models using different backbone and heads |
| - [ssd_mobilenetv1_pt](https://github.com/STMicroelectronics/stm32ai-modelzoo/blob/master/object_classification/ssd_mobilenetv1_pt/README.md) β Single shot detector with MobilenetV1 backbone |
| - [ssd_mobilenetv2_pt](https://github.com/STMicroelectronics/stm32ai-modelzoo/blob/master/object_classification/ssd_mobilenetv2_pt/README.md) β Single shot detector with MobilenetV2 backbone |
| - [ssdlite_mobilenetv1_pt](https://github.com/STMicroelectronics/stm32ai-modelzoo/blob/master/object_classification/ssdlite_mobilenetv1_pt/README.md) β Single shot detector lite with MobilenetV1 backbone |
| - [ssdlite_mobilenetv2_pt](https://github.com/STMicroelectronics/stm32ai-modelzoo/blob/master/object_classification/ssdlite_mobilenetv2_pt/README.md) β Single shot detector lite with MobilenetV2 backbone |
| - [ssdlite_mobilenetv3mall_pt](https://github.com/STMicroelectronics/stm32ai-modelzoo/blob/master/object_classification/ssdlite_mobilenetv3mall_pt/README.md) β Single shot detector lite with MobilenetV3small backbone |
| - [ssdlite_mobilenetv3large_pt](https://github.com/STMicroelectronics/stm32ai-modelzoo/blob/master/object_classification/ssdlite_mobilenetv3large_pt/README.md) β Single shot detector lite with MobilenetV3large backbone |
|
|
| ### ST_YOLOD Models |
| STMicroelectronics in house developed model especially optimized for size and memory with a competitive performance on Imagenet (and other datasets) |
| - [st_yolodv2milli_pt](https://github.com/STMicroelectronics/stm32ai-modelzoo/blob/master/object_classification/st_yolodv2milli_pt/README.md) β Extreme compression of STResNet for backbone and YOLOX head and modified YOLOX neck. |
| - [st_yolodv2tiny_pt](https://github.com/STMicroelectronics/stm32ai-modelzoo/blob/master/object_classification/st_yolodv2tiny_pt/README.md) β Extreme compression of STResNet for backbone and YOLOX head and modified YOLOX neck. |
